Psychological Types
A concept proposed by Carl Jung that categorizes individuals according to their primary mode of psychological functioning, such as thinking, feeling, sensing, or intuiting.
Myers-Briggs Type Indicator
A widely used personality assessment tool that categorizes individuals into sixteen personality types based on preferences in how they perceive the world and make decisions.
Word-Association Test
The word-association test is a psychological test in which individuals are asked to respond with the first word that comes to mind upon hearing a given word, used to explore unconscious associations.
